@sindreaarhusnarvestad: We’ve been rendering buildings at birth. Every new render freezes architecture at its cleanest moment, then asks the real building to spend the rest of its life drifting away from that image. Piranesi drew ruins. Soane commissioned his Bank of England as a future ruin before the building had even aged. Ruskin saw the marks of time as part of architecture’s beauty. Maybe we should start drawing the moss earlier. A building deserves to be imagined as something that will live.

Patina should be a design parameter. Robust materials like brass, copper, oak and natural stone weather with grace when you detail them so water and time do the finishing work.
